The jury was dismissed. Kaitlin Armstrong was brought up front to the judge. The courtroom went silent. Her defense attorney Rick Cofer explained to her her rights and asked her if she would like to testify on her own behalf. It was an incredibly serious conversation and you could hear a pin drop in the courtroom. Armstrong said she does not wish to testify in this murder trial. She was then escorted out of the courtroom. There is now a sidebar with the judge with both attorney teams, but I believe the defense is sharing that they are resting their case. Standby for official confirmation.

There were several interesting moments in that exchange I want to note: Kaitlin Armstrong seemed confused, even scared, in that moment. It was as if she couldn't speak. Rick Cofer was asking her direct questions and making sure she understood her rights as a defendant. She was staring right back at him. He had to say, "this isn't a trick question." When he asked if she wanted to testify, I believe she answered, "not." Not no, but "not." That led to more confusion and Cofer had to make sure she meant no. Overall, while Armstrong has been seemingly quiet and stoic, I watched that exchange unfold and begin to wonder if she is scared stiff at what is happening around her.

The defense has rested its case, but the state has called a new witness: Dr. Tim Kalafut, a forensic scientist from Sam Houston State University. He has authored several articles on DNA analysis.
